## Important Notes

We have had security audits performed on OAuth2 Proxy in the past couple of weeks and as a result we have fixed
several CRITICAL vulnerabilities.

The security vulnerabilities include multiple authentication bypasses and a potential session fixation attack.
For more details and to identify if you are effects, we urge all users of OAuth2 Proxy to read the security 
disclosures.

- (Critical) [GHSA-5hvv-m4w4-gf6v](https://github.com/oauth2-proxy/oauth2-proxy/security/advisories/GHSA-5hvv-m4w4-gf6v) fix: health check user-agent authentication bypass 
- (Critical) [GHSA-7x63-xv5r-3p2x](https://github.com/oauth2-proxy/oauth2-proxy/security/advisories/GHSA-7x63-xv5r-3p2x) fix: authentication bypass via X-Forwarded-Uri header spoofing
- (High) [GHSA-pxq7-h93f-9jrg](https://github.com/oauth2-proxy/oauth2-proxy/security/advisories/GHSA-pxq7-h93f-9jrg) fix: fragment evaluation as part of the allowed routes
- (Moderate) [GHSA-c5c4-8r6x-56w3](https://github.com/oauth2-proxy/oauth2-proxy/security/advisories/GHSA-c5c4-8r6x-56w3) fix: email validation bypass via malformed multi-@ email claims

Furthermore, for improving the security of OAuth2 Proxy we introduced a new flag `--trusted-proxy-ip` that allows users
to explicitly specify trusted reverse proxy IPs for the `X-Forwarded-*` headers. This is an important step to prevent 
potential header spoofing attacks and to ensure that OAuth2 Proxy only trusts headers from known and trusted sources.
We highly recommend users to review their deployment architecture and consider using this flag to enhance the security 
of their OAuth2 Proxy instances. Check the docs for more details: https://oauth2-proxy.github.io/oauth2-proxy/configuration/overview#proxy-options
